Hong Kong will initiate a two-month public consultation on June 15th for its inaugural five-year development plan. This plan aims to align the city's growth with national objectives across sectors like housing, land, health, and welfare. Chief Executive John Lee Ka-chiu announced the consultation, emphasizing its historic significance and the government's intent to gather broad public and sector-specific input. AI
